Output 61ff6ba3d29f143a104d94f3d37899ea32bbd105a1581b4cc7a90bf0d6f1c066:35
- value
- 128312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de88dc3d25a563f854acfd7e9db453d06261a720 OP_EQUAL
- address
- 3MyftMK5EZwDgpeVGQBRBrhTYAfqW3zPqJ
- transaction
- 61ff6ba3d29f143a104d94f3d37899ea32bbd105a1581b4cc7a90bf0d6f1c066
- spent
- true